Open-access Non-pharmacological interdisciplinary rehabilitation in dementia: a qualitative study of Brazilian non-professional caregivers’ perspectives

Reabilitação interdisciplinar não farmacológica na demência: um estudo qualitativo sobre as perspectivas de cuidadores brasileiros não profissionais

ABSTRACT

Objectives:  This study evaluated the perceptions of non-professional caregivers regarding a community-based dementia care service and examined the preliminary effects and adherence to an interdisciplinary program with culturally adapted interventions in Brazil.

Methods:  A retrospective textual analysis of 17 caregiver testimonials from 30 dyads was conducted using IRaMuTeQ software and descending hierarchical classification method. The Chi-square test assessed associations between words and lexical classes.

Results:  Six categories emerged: Positive restructuring of disease perception and coping strategies; Learning and improving disease management; Learning and adapting to the caregiver role; Behavioral transformations and re-engagement in activities; Recognition and appreciation of the humanized and interdisciplinary approach; and Positive impacts of participation in rehabilitation programs. The average weekly attendance rate was 89.02% (±10.65%). Caregivers reported a shift from fear and stigma to acceptance and more proactive management, with increased confidence, emotional well-being, and preparedness. Shared experiences and support networks were valued, as was the person-centered care model. Participation was perceived as transformative and beneficial to family dynamics.

Conclusion:  The program demonstrated high adherence and cultural appropriateness, with promising preliminary outcomes. Further studies are needed to evaluate its long-term effectiveness and potential applicability in broader settings.

INTRODUCTION

Caregivers of people with dementia face emotional, financial, and physical challenges associated with burden, depression, anxiety, and insufficient support.1-3 Behavioral and psychological symptoms of dementia exacerbate these challenges, increasing the likelihood of institutionalization and abuse against care recipients.4,5 In low- and middle-income countries, dementia care is additionally constrained by underfunded healthcare systems, underdiagnosis in early stages, and a high prevalence of modifiable risk factors,6 often compounded by limited access to training and insufficient family support, despite caregivers’ interest in receiving guidance.7,8

Globally, families play a central role in dementia care.7 Thus, including family members in the rehabilitation process is essential for training and supporting them, with group interventions being particularly recommended due to their positive effects.9,10 However, most structured dementia interventions have been developed in high-income countries, frequently limiting their applicability to different sociocultural contexts.11 To address this gap, linguistic and cultural adaptations that consider local needs are essential.12 Within this framework, person-centered care is fundamental, as it acknowledges the dignity, values, and specific needs of people living with dementia while also recognizing caregivers as integral to comprehensive care. 9,13

Among caregiver-focused strategies, psychoeducation plays a key role by providing information and guidance on disease management, enhancing self-efficacy, and reducing anxiety, depression, and burden.14-16 When combined with psychoeducation, cognitive rehabilitation supports people with dementia in managing daily activities by reinforcing preserved abilities and promoting functionality and social participation, with an emphasis on meaningful goals rather than isolated cognitive skills.17,18

People with dementia often require simultaneous interventions from various healthcare services, and fragmented or poorly coordinated care may result in repetitive and inadequate services.19 In this scenario, integrated care emerges as a strategy to improve the quality of services by promoting effective coordination among different professionals.20,21

In Brazil, evidence on interdisciplinary non-pharmacological interventions in dementia care remains limited. Existing studies have focused primarily on individuals with Alzheimer's disease, often with limited integration of caregivers into intervention processes.22,23 Notably, a Brazilian controlled clinical trial examining a multidisciplinary cognitive stimulation program targeted individuals with mild Alzheimer's disease and their caregivers but adopted a broader inclusion criterion, encompassing participants classified as both CDR 0.5 and CDR 1.0.25 Despite these efforts, research on interdisciplinary rehabilitation programs that simultaneously address the needs of people with dementia and their caregivers remains scarce in Brazil.

Assessing service quality delivered to people with dementia is essential for improving care, allocating resources efficiently, and enhancing user experience, as it yields data on the impact of interventions on families and society.26 Thus, evaluating caregivers’ perceptions of community-based dementia care services is crucial, as they play a central role in daily care and decision-making processes.26 In this context, this study aims to advance knowledge by evaluating the perceptions of non-professional caregivers regarding community-based dementia care services. Within this framework, it examines the preliminary effects and participants’ adherence to an interdisciplinary program that incorporates person-centered and multicomponent interventions, which were culturally adapted for the Brazilian context.

METHOD

This was a retrospective and qualitative study that analyzed caregivers’ perceptions and the reported impacts. Participants were admitted to the Sarah International Center for Neurorehabilitation and Neuroscience in Rio de Janeiro, Brazil, and enrolled in the Integrated Activities - Neurocognition program, designed for Alzheimer's disease during the program's implementation period in 2024. The sample consisted of people diagnosed with AD according to the criteria of the Diagnostic and Statistical Manual of Mental Disorders (DSM-5),27 classified as being in the mild stage (CDR 1) according to the Clinical Dementia Rating,28,29 along with their respective caregivers, totaling 30 dyads.

Alzheimer's disease diagnoses were established during routine clinical care by experienced neurologists or geriatricians at the neurorehabilitation center, based on medical history, neurological examination, cognitive assessment, and structured diagnostic interviews using standardized templates routinely applied in the service. All participants underwent routine laboratory testing and structural magnetic resonance imaging (MRI) as part of the standard diagnostic workup. In addition, some participants underwent complementary diagnostic procedures available at the institution, such as comprehensive neuropsychological assessment, cerebrospinal fluid (CSF) analysis, and genetic testing, when clinically indicated. These additional procedures were not systematically performed in all participants and were not standardized for research purposes.

Program Description

The program was developed in response to growing demand for structured support for individuals with mild AD and training for their caregivers to manage the condition continuously. The interdisciplinary model, delivered over a fixed period, was designed to provide a holistic, personalized, and cost-effective group intervention. Prior to the program's implementation, people with AD and their families received assistance individually from various professionals at different times, without integrated planning or continuity of care. This approach resulted in increased rehabilitation costs, led to redundant care, and restricted opportunities for families to share experiences with others in similar situations.

The main significant challenge in establishing the program was the limited availability of physical space within the facility, as other groups operated simultaneously. This constraint required negotiations between programs, methodological adaptations, and intervention schedule reorganizations to ensure service quality. Overcoming this issue depends on external factors beyond the team, but it is expected to be mitigated in the future with the ongoing expansion of infrastructure.

As the program evolved, the team refined its approach by identifying more effective strategies, techniques, and communication methods to enhance caregiver training, increase engagement among people with AD, and optimize program management. The intervention was developed based on theoretical frameworks.10,30 However, the implementation was adapted to the Brazilian context, considering the specific needs and main concerns reported by caregivers, the clinical stage of the disease, and the composition of the team.

Furthermore, the adapted intervention incorporated context-sensitive language and included practical examples drawn from everyday Brazilian life. By reflecting the local culture, these elements not only enhanced participant engagement but also simplify the understanding of the guidelines. This approach ensures that participants can better relate to the material, making it easier for them to apply the guidelines in real-life situations. Ultimately, this cultural relevance is a key factor in promoting effective learning and long-term adherence.

In 2024, the program lasted eight weeks, with weekly 120-minute sessions conducted by an interdisciplinary team comprising a dance teacher, neuropsychologist, nurse, pharmacist, physical education teacher, and physiotherapist. Additionally, a geriatrician was available for specific cases. At the end of each session, the team held one-hour meetings to discuss cases, evaluate participants’ adherence, adjust interventions according to group profiles, and register in an electronic medical record.

Chart shows the distribution of activities across the intervention weeks. To monitor outcomes beyond program completion, a follow-up session was conducted 16 weeks after each program edition. Therefore, a group follow-up session was conducted to monitor adherence to recommendations, reinforce best practices, and identify potential changes in disease progression.

Procedure

Clinical and sociodemographic data were systematically collected from electronic medical records to offer a comprehensive profile of the participants involved in the program. As part of the program evaluation, on the final day of each 8-week program cycle, we collected video-recorded testimonials from caregivers, all of whom voluntarily chose to participate and provided written informed consent, including authorization for image use. These caregivers were interviewed through semi-structured formats, designed to create an open dialogue while ensuring that we focused specifically on the central question: "What is your perception of the program?"

During the first edition of the program, eight caregivers did not share testimonials, as this practice had not yet been implemented. In the second edition, one dyad missed the final session due to a prior engagement in another city. In the third edition, one caregiver opted out of recording due to discomfort speaking in public. In the fourth edition, two dyads missed the final session due to health issues, and one caregiver was replaced by a family member who participated for the first time. Consequently, 17 testimonials were collected from the 30 caregivers.

During the interviews, caregivers shared their experiences, impressions, and any changes they observed as a result of their involvement in the program. The recorded testimonials were meticulously transcribed for accuracy, and then manually refined to enhance clarity. This refining process involved eliminating non-communicative elements, such as filler words and repetitive statements, to ensure that the final analysis captured the essence of the caregivers’ perspectives more effectively. Through this detailed examination of their feedback, we aimed to gain valuable insights into the program's impact on those directly involved.

Analysis

Statistical analyses were performed using Statistical Package for the Social Sciences.32 Categorical Variables were described as frequencies and percentages, while continuous variables were expressed as means and Standard Deviations (SD).

Textual analysis of the testimonials was conducted using the Interface de R pour les Analyses Multidimensionnelles de Textes et de Questionnaires (IRaMuTeQ), version 0.8-alpha-7. The Descending Hierarchical Classification (DHC)33 method was applied to identify elementary context unit classes with similar vocabulary within groups and distinct vocabulary between groups.34 Results were presented in dendrogram and DHC words lists. The Chi-square test (χ²) was used to evaluate associations between words and lexical classes, considering words significant when χ²>3.80 and p<0.05.34

RESULTS

The sample included 30 dyads. The mean educational level of people with dementia was 10.13 years (SD ± 4.91). Cognitive performance, assessed using the Mini-Mental State Examination (MMSE),35,36 showed an average score of 20.50 (SD ± 4.56), considering 28 individuals. Two individuals with AD were assessed using alternative cognitive assessment tools due to early-onset dementia syndrome. Table presents a detailed description of the participants’ characteristics.

Table.
Participants Characteristics

The general corpus consisted of 17 texts, divided into 93 text segments (TS), with 70 TS (75.27%) retained for analysis. A total of 3,248 lexical occurrences were identified, of which 790 words were unique, and 457 appeared only once. The textual content was analyzed using IRaMuTeQ and classified into six categories, qualitatively named as follows — Class 1: Positive restructuring of disease perception and coping strategies (9 TS; 12.86%); Class 2: Learning and improving disease management (17 TS; 24.29%); Class 3: Learning and adaptation to the caregiver role (12 TS; 17.14%); Class 4: Behavioral transformations and re-engagement in activities (9 TS; 12.86%); Class 5: Recognition and appreciation of the humanized and interdisciplinary approach (12 TS; 17.14%); and Class 6: Positive impacts of participation in rehabilitation programs (11 TS; 15.71%). Figure presents a dendrogram with the complete words lists for each class.

Positive restructuring of disease perception and coping strategies

Class 1 explores how participants coped with the initial impact of an AD diagnosis and its progression. Initially, the syndrome was associated with stigma, fears, and uncertainties, described as a challenging life event. In most accounts, this process evolved into a gradual acceptance of the disease as part of everyday life, accompanied by the adoption of practical strategies to manage it. Caregivers emphasized the fundamental role of knowledge, patience, and emotional support in promoting positive interactions and strengthening resilience in daily challenges. Furthermore, they recognized the importance of interventions in slowing disease progression and optimizing the quality of life of individuals with dementia.

"This chapter will close with sadness, but even more with joy, because I learned to recognize and deal with this disease. The word ‘Alzheimer's’ is frightening, but if you know how to handle it, it becomes easier to accept." (Caregiver 12).

"Alzheimer's, in reality, is just another disease, like any other. We must understand that it is simply another phase of life." (Caregiver 25).

"I see Alzheimer's today with a bit more ease. It is still difficult because there are times when my mother has crises and wants to leave the house, but I have learned to see the disease in a lighter way." (Caregiver 27).

Learning and improvement in disease management

Class 2 highlights knowledge gains about AD and strategies to handle caregiving challenges. Lectures, meetings, and a welcoming environment were identified as key elements in developing effective management and adaptation strategies. Testimonies indicate that caregivers feel more prepared to face daily challenges, reporting a reduction in previous anxiety and feelings of disorientation. Many emphasized that they learned to create a healthier and more harmonious environment, adopting empathetic approaches and avoiding unnecessary confrontations. Additionally, participants acknowledged that conscious acceptance of the disease, covered in Class 1, combined with the knowledge acquired, enables more humanized and effective management.

"I was feeling rebellious, I was lost. But at Sarah, through lectures, meetings, and the support we received, I started to shape my way of handling things and to better understand the situation. Honestly, after the program, I manage things much better now." (Caregiver 11).

"We learned how to handle the disease, to acknowledge and accept it. The anxiety and fear we had, in these two months at Sarah, have disappeared." (Caregiver 22).

"I am managing to take care of my father in a better and more welcoming way. I am learning how to deal with all of this." (Caregiver 23).

Learning and adaptation to the caregiver role

Developing a better understanding allowed caregivers to cultivate greater empathy and confidence, improving their ability to recognize both the individual's limitations and their own. Across multiple narratives, caregivers described this process as being associated with a perceived reduction in the emotional burden of caregiving. Additionally, interactions among families during program activities were identified as a crucial component. Sharing experiences helped caregivers relate to one another, strengthening their support network. The reframing of the disease (Class 1) and the acquisition of management skills (Class 2) facilitated self-acceptance and increased self-efficacy in caregiving, allowing family members to fully adapt to their roles (Class 3).

"We think we know everything, but we don't. We barely recognize the disease stages. This group was incredibly insightful, both in small details and major aspects, even in the bureaucratic part." (Caregiver 15).

"I found this experience very productive. I am deeply grateful to all professionals. We didn't just learn from them, but also from our relatives, other families, and the patients themselves." (Caregiver 18).

"Here, I felt welcomed, supported, and guided toward appropriate behavior to coexist with the disease and help my wife in the best way possible." (Caregiver 24).

Behavioral transformations and re-engagement in activities

Class 4 addresses potential behavioral changes in people with AD, particularly regarding their participation in daily and social activities. These transformations were attributed to enhanced autonomy in a safe environment and increased well-being.

"We started this project for both caregivers and patients, and it has been incredibly beneficial. Even though I work in healthcare, we often want to protect patients too much and end up preventing them from doing things. You showed us the opposite—that we need to provide them with a safe level of autonomy to remain as independent as possible." (Caregiver 9).

"I don't know if she noticed, but she was very discouraged, always lying down, with no interest in doing anything. Today, she is much more enthusiastic—she resumed her activities, wants to go out and interacts more. This follow-up was very important for us." (Caregiver 13).

"I have learned how to understand my mother's disease and how to live with it, even during crises. Sometimes she gets nervous and wants to leave and we didn't know how to handle that. There was a lot of conflict at home, but we started to learn how to act and shared that knowledge with other family members. Now, we are much better." (Caregiver 29).

Recognition and appreciation of the humanized and interdisciplinary approach

Humanized care was frequently mentioned as a key factor in addressing the challenges of the disease. Caregivers emphasized the importance of comprehensive and person-centered support, respecting the individual needs of each dyad.

"They forget the ‘I love you,’ they forget they had ice cream, but you teach us how to deal with this reality." (Caregiver 12).

"Everyone here is so kind. The care was excellent and the interdisciplinary team was incredible. They guided us on how to move forward." (Caregiver 13).

"We participated in the group for eight sessions, and it was a turning point for all of us. Not only for my mother, who, as a patient, was able to explore her potential and understand what keeps her present, but also for us as caregivers. This multidisciplinary perspective was crucial." (Caregiver 15).

Positive impacts of participation in rehabilitation programs

Testimonies indicate that the sessions helped empower caregivers in managing caregiving challenges, improve their skills, and strengthen social and family bonds. Additionally, the program was perceived not just as a set of clinical interventions, but as a space for personal and collective growth, emotional support, and improved quality of life.

"This was incredible. The way this team prepared us for the future—it felt like a school, teaching us and preparing us for what lies ahead. Please invite us to more of these meetings. These tips are incredible and truly make a difference." (Caregiver 14).

"I found the program extremely valuable." (Caregiver 18).

"I learned from you the best way to handle the disease. Before, I didn't have this awareness. My message is this: I think Sarah should have units throughout the entire country, not just in the capitals, for the benefit of the many Brazilians in remote areas. It would be invaluable to treat people who don't even realize they have Alzheimer's and that it is progressing." (Caregiver 24).

Critical reflections for program improvement

Although the software did not identify, within the statistical parameters, a set of text segments related to criticisms or negative aspects of the program, it is essential to present the excerpts in which participants express critical perceptions, challenges faced, and suggestions for improvement. A few participants offered critical insights regarding emotional discomfort, structural limitations, and accessibility of the program, reinforcing the importance of considering participant voices beyond the dominant lexical patterns statistically identified.

One caregiver highlighted the limited duration of the intervention, suggesting that an extended program could yield more sustained benefits while acknowledging the need to serve more families:

"It's a pity it lasts only eight weeks, but I understand that the time limit allows more families to participate." (Caregiver 18).

Another participant noted the emotional burden experienced by a patient with early-onset dementia, at age 54, when confronted with the progression of the disease:

"…but with my father, it's very different, and it was very good in every way—for us—but for him, I particularly feel that he doesn't like it, because when he comes here, he sees what awaits him in the future. And that is very painful for him. He doesn't say it, but his body speaks to us." (Caregiver 23).

Issues related to geographic accessibility were also raised. One caregiver expressed frustration with the concentration of services in major urban centers, emphasizing the need for expansion into underserved regions:

"My message is this: I think Sarah should have units throughout the entire country, not just in the capitals, for the benefit of the many Brazilians in remote areas." (Caregiver 24).

Another caregiver commented on the limited public awareness of the program, suggesting the need for broader dissemination of information to increase community access:

"…I really think Sarah should be more widely publicized, so people know about it — I didn't even know it was a hospital." (Caregiver 27).

DISCUSSION

This study examined the preliminary effects and participants’ adherence to an interdisciplinary program with multicomponent interventions. The results of the interdisciplinary rehabilitation program indicate benefits for participants. First, a positive transformation was observed in caregivers’ perception and coping strategies regarding the disease. This aspect is particularly important, as dysfunctional coping styles are associated with increased depressive and anxious symptoms, as well as greater caregiver burden.37 This shift in perception may contribute to alleviating behavioral and psychological symptoms of dementia, improving care quality, and potentially slowing disease progression.38

Additionally, an improvement in caregivers’ knowledge and ability to manage the disease was reported. Similar findings were reported in a five-week psychoeducational program for individuals with dementia and their caregivers, which demonstrated that educational approaches facilitated greater disease understanding, improved communication, and enhanced caregiving skills in daily life.39 Likewise, another six-week psychoeducational program for people in the early stages of dementia and their caregivers found improvements in mutual care planning, increased use of support services, reduced distressing emotions, and high levels of intervention acceptance and satisfaction.40

These changes facilitated caregiver role acceptance and recognition, aligning with studies that associate psychoeducational and multicomponent interventions with increased confidence and competence in dementia management.6,18 A systematic review highlighted the benefits of multicomponent interventions and occupational therapy in enhancing caregiver self-efficacy.41 These findings reinforce the potential benefit of including occupational therapists in the present program.

The testimonials also indicate behavioral changes and increased social engagement among individuals with dementia. However, the literature presents conflicting findings regarding multicomponent programs, with studies reporting positive effects, no impact, or even worsening of behavioral symptoms.42-45 Further research is needed to verify the occurrence of these divergent outcomes and, when improvements are observed, to determine whether they result directly from interventions targeting people with dementia or indirectly as a reflection of improvements in caregivers’ coping and management strategies. It would also be valuable to assess which specific components (e.g., physical, cognitive, or emotional activities) are more closely associated with these behavioral improvements.

The interdisciplinary approach, combined with a humanized and person-centered care model, emerged across multiple participant narratives as one of the perceived core strengths of the program. Previous studies emphasize the importance of personalizing interventions and addressing individual needs, avoiding an exclusive reliance on quantitative measures.46 However, more specific tools may be necessary to precisely assess the benefits of this approach in psychosocial programs for individuals with dementia. The inclusion of qualitative outcome measures, such as caregiver satisfaction scales and patient-reported experience metrics, should be considered to complement clinical assessments.

Participation in the program demonstrated potential for enhancing caregiving skills, providing emotional support, expanding support networks, and improving participants’ quality of life. These findings align with the literature, which suggests that dyadic and person-centered psychoeducational programs enhance cognitive, physical, and social functioning in individuals with dementia.47 The high attendance rate among dyads suggests cultural appropriateness, supporting previous evidence that emphasizes the importance of practical and accessible programs tailored to family needs to improve adherence.48

The inclusion of the manually constructed category Critical reflections for program improvement revealed relevant insights that, although less frequent, offer significant contributions to the refinement of dementia care programs. The emotional discomfort reported in relation to a participant with early-onset dementia, when confronted with the progression of Alzheimer's disease and engaged in activities alongside people with late-onset dementia, highlights the need for age-sensitive approaches that consider the psychological impact of group-based interventions. This finding is consistent with a study showing that individuals with young-onset dementia tend to exhibit greater awareness of their condition compared to those with late-onset dementia, even at similar levels of functional impairment.49 This preserved awareness, while facilitating a better understanding of one's condition, has also been associated with lower self-perceived quality of life, indicating greater emotional vulnerability.49 Thus, future designs could benefit from subgrouping participants not only by cognitive stage but also by age of onset and psychosocial profile.

Similarly, the criticism regarding the program's eight-week duration points to the need for follow-up strategies or extended care models that support the continued assistance of dyads. However, it is important to consider that the program's limited duration is also related to maintaining its feasibility and cost-effectiveness, balancing high-quality care with broader access for the greatest possible number of families. Short-cycle rotation allows for more users to be included over time, promoting equitable use of available resources. Nonetheless, the implementation of optional booster sessions or support groups after program completion could maintain benefits over time.

Additionally, issues such as limited geographic accessibility were raised by a participant who advocated for the decentralization of services. Although this demand is legitimate, it goes beyond the institution's scope of governance and depends on political and administrative commitment to secure public funding and infrastructure expansion — including the establishment of new units in underserved regions. It is worth noting that locating services in strategic urban centers enables the program to reach a significant number of individuals, thereby maximizing its coverage. Collaboration with primary care networks and telehealth strategies could partially mitigate geographic barriers and improve accessibility.

Regarding institutional visibility, while a participant expressed that the service could benefit from broader dissemination, it is important to highlight that the institution already operates with high demand and substantial waiting lists. Therefore, any increase in visibility must be accompanied by a proportional expansion of human resources and infrastructure to ensure service quality. In this context, organic dissemination by the families themselves, along with the dissemination of scientific findings — such as the present study — plays a meaningful role in strengthening the institution's image and raising public awareness about the importance of person-centered care and interdisciplinary intervention policies.

Adapting the program to the Brazilian context requires considering the country's socio-cultural and economic particularities, especially those of the Southeastern region where the study was conducted. Given that families in this region tend to be smaller compared to other parts of Brazil,50 the program aimed to build support networks among caregivers, fostering experience-sharing and strengthening bonds to compensate for the absence of extended family. Additionally, in a cultural context where social hierarchy is valued,50 promoting a more horizontal relationship between caregivers and healthcare professionals is essential, encouraging caregivers’ active participation in care-related decisions. Adapting the language and interventions using practical examples from Brazilian daily life and activities that reflect local culture can enhance participant engagement, and facilitate the comprehension and application of guidelines.12 Group interventions promote the program's economic sustainability and are generally more effective for caregivers.9 Still, future versions should consider tailoring approaches to low-income participants and rural populations who may face additional barriers.

The program also addressed common challenges, such as a lack of trust among professionals and the absence of a centralized database.19 Regular team meetings and the use of electronic medical records contributed to more integrated care. However, scheduling conflicts for dyad participation have been identified as an obstacle.51 Future studies should assess whether this factor is the primary reason for non-participation in the present program and whether expanding session availability could be a viable strategy to address this issue.

The retrospective and qualitative study design, combined with the absence of a control group, limits the generalizability of findings and the determination of program effectiveness. Brazil is a vast country with large economic and cultural differences, and the participants were from only one Brazilian city. This may have led to sampling bias, with findings not being representative of other settings across Brazil. Additionally, convenience sampling may introduce selection bias, reflecting predominantly the characteristics of included participants. Furthermore, the absence of 13 caregiver testimonials among the 30 participants may have resulted in unreported or underrepresented data, particularly with regard to certain caregiver experiences. Moreover, no quantitative data were collected on caregivers’ mood or burden, which could have offered further insights into the program's impact. Finally, it is essential to explore whether the benefits reported by caregivers are maintained over time, highlighting the need for longitudinal follow-up studies.

CONCLUSION

The high adherence rate, participants’ desire for continuity, and positive evaluations underscore the cultural relevance and acceptability of the intervention for the Brazilian context. These findings support the feasibility of adapting models originally developed in high-income countries to middle-income settings, provided they are culturally and contextually tailored. The successful implementation of similar initiatives on a broader scale will depend on sustained investment in infrastructure, funding, and the prioritization of non-pharmacological interventions within public health policies. Additionally, caregivers’ perceptions of the care provided in community-based centers are a key aspect, given their pivotal role in daily dementia management, rehabilitation efforts, and the identification of emerging needs.

Incorporating these perspectives can inform service refinement, contributing to more effective and compassionate care strategies that benefit both individuals with dementia and their caregivers. While the current results are promising, they remain preliminary. Further longitudinal and controlled studies are needed to rigorously evaluate the program's efficacy, explore its long-term outcomes, and determine the generalizability of these findings to other regions and populations.
